Local housing stock
Building in Atlanta clusters in the late 1980s: the median unit dates to 1989, with 50.5 percent finished before 1990. A wide mix, from pre-war bungalows in the intown neighborhoods to extensive post-1980 building outward, largely wood frame over crawlspaces or basements cut into sloping lots.
Climate & seasonal risk
Atlanta averages 51.8 inches of precipitation a year on the 1991–2020 normals, taken at ATLANTA 2.3 NE 2.3 miles away, with July the wettest month at 5.06 inches. Summer thunderstorms land on dense red clay that absorbs slowly, so runoff moves across the surface toward whatever is downhill. On the rolling terrain here that is frequently a crawlspace vent or a basement wall.
Common moisture and mold problems in Atlanta
- Red clay absorbing rainfall slowly and sending summer storm runoff across the surface
- Crawlspaces on sloping lots receiving water that has traveled downhill from higher ground
- High summer humidity keeping crawlspace and basement moisture elevated for months
- Basements cut into hillsides where the uphill wall bears against saturated clay
